What is a supplement stack?
A supplement stack is a targeted combination of supplements chosen to support a specific goal, such as energy, metabolism, hormones, recovery, sleep, immune health, gut health, or healthy aging.
How is a supplement stack different from taking random supplements?
A supplement stack is intentional. Instead of choosing products based on trends or online ads, your stack is built around your goals, symptoms, current treatments, and overall health plan.

Do I need lab work before starting supplements?
Not always, but lab work can be helpful. Labs may help identify nutrient deficiencies, hormone issues, metabolic concerns, or other factors that can guide your plan.

Are supplement stacks safe?
Supplement safety depends on the ingredients, dose, quality, your medical history, and medications. That is why provider guidance is important.
Can supplements interact with medications?
Yes. Some supplements can interact with medications or may not be appropriate for certain health conditions. Always tell your provider what you are taking.

Do supplements replace healthy eating?
No. Supplements are meant to support your health, not replace food, protein, hydration, sleep, movement, or medical care.
